How Senior Care is Shaping AI's Role in Healthcare

Follow us

When a senior care facility in Michigan rolled out an AI-powered dining robot, it stirred up quite the mix of reactions. The residents were mostly thrilled about this leap into the future, seeing it as a sign of their facility's forward-thinking approach. The staff, however, had some reservations, worried that this new tech might edge them out of their jobs.

This sort of push-and-pull is pretty common whenever AI steps into the healthcare arena. But if we handle it right, AI can actually be a great partner for healthcare workers. It can take on physically demanding tasks, cut down on repetitive chores, and help make things run more smoothly. This is especially crucial for an aging workforce that might find the physical demands of caregiving increasingly tough.

AI's Expanding Role in Healthcare

AI is becoming a key player in healthcare, and that's partly because the industry is grappling with major staff shortages. Nurses, primary care doctors, and mental health professionals are all in short supply. Looking ahead, these shortages are expected to get worse, especially in rural and underserved areas, as the global population ages and healthcare needs grow. The Health Resources and Services Administration (HRSA) predicts a shortfall of 187,130 physicians by 2037.

In senior care, the staffing crisis is even more pronounced. Burnout is on the rise, and while new workers often lack proper training, experienced staff are feeling the physical strain of their roles. Since March 2020, U.S. nursing homes have seen a loss of about 235,000 jobs, roughly 15% of the workforce. This has left over a fifth of nursing homes nationwide struggling with inadequate staffing.

To tackle this staffing crisis, a multi-pronged approach is needed. This includes better pay, improved training programs, and the integration of supportive technologies. AI is a crucial part of this solution.

Reducing Burnout and Improving Workflows

AI-driven tools are already making a difference by cutting out unnecessary tasks and easing administrative burdens. For instance, ambient listening tools can automate documentation by recording and summarizing patient visits, drafting referrals, and coding visits for insurance. This helps reduce the late-night charting burden on providers, freeing up time for direct patient care.

AI in imaging is also making waves, offering tumor detection capabilities that were once unimaginable. This eases the load on radiologists and pathologists by providing more accurate diagnostics, which in turn improves clinical decisions. Collaborative robots, or cobots, are enhancing workflows by fetching medical records, patient belongings, and medications, allowing nurses and other clinical staff to focus more on patient care.

For AI to be widely accepted, whether in senior care or other healthcare settings, it's crucial to involve stakeholders in its selection and implementation. Without buy-in from staff and patients, resistance is inevitable.

Enhancing Senior Well-being with AI

Beyond helping staff, AI is also transforming the care itself. It's helping seniors stay mentally sharp, safe, and independent for longer. One standout tool is a Swiss-designed "exer-gaming" device that aids seniors in improving cognitive function, balance, and reflexes. In a pilot program with 36 residents over eight weeks, cognitive errors dropped by 30-50%, and response times improved significantly.

For some, this technology has been life-changing. One woman with Parkinson’s saw her gait and reflexes improve after a year of using the device, eventually managing exercises without support—something she never thought possible.

AI tools are also boosting confidence and independence, reducing the risk of falls and hospitalizations. However, keeping users engaged can be challenging. Like any fitness routine, initial enthusiasm can wane. The key is ongoing encouragement and social motivation to form lasting habits.

AI is also making strides in medication management, with tools that support independence and lighten staff workloads. These tools can enhance adherence and outcomes, especially when seamlessly integrated into daily routines.

Lessons for Innovators

For those looking to innovate in healthcare, there are a few key takeaways:

  • Design with dignity in mind: Patients, especially seniors, shy away from tech that feels clinical or infantilizing. Sleek, discreet designs are more likely to be embraced.

  • Focus on independence: The best AI solutions empower users to maintain control over their lives. For example, AI-powered autonomous wheelchairs can offer greater mobility without relying on caregivers.

  • Co-create with real-world input: Engaging caregivers, clinicians, and patients early in the design process leads to better outcomes and adoption.

The future of AI in healthcare is promising, with senior care innovations offering a glimpse of what’s to come. Successful AI technologies will improve outcomes, ease burdens, and increase autonomy. But technology alone isn’t enough. Thoughtful implementation, stakeholder involvement, and a commitment to preserving dignity and autonomy are essential. By embracing these principles, we can build a more efficient, compassionate, and enduring healthcare system.
